๐ŸŒฟ Natural stain removal methods

  1. Salt: Sprinkle salt on the fresh stain and leave for 10 minutes. Then rinse with cold water.
  2. Lemon juice: Works great on berry stains. Simply apply to the stain and leave for 15 minutes, then rinse.
  3. Vinegar: Mix vinegar and water in equal proportions and treat the stain.

๐Ÿ‡ Specifics of stains from different berries and fruits

๐Ÿ’ Cherry

Cherry stains are among the most stubborn stains. It is better to immediately treat a fresh stain with salt or lemon juice. If the stain is โ€œold,โ€ then vinegar or a specialized stain remover will help.

๐Ÿ“ Strawberry

Strawberry stains can be easily removed with cold water and salt. You can also use lemon juice or vinegar by applying it to the stain and leaving it on for 15 minutes.

๐Ÿ‰ Watermelon

Watermelon stains are usually not as persistent as those from other berries. Cold water and regular soap will do the job.

๐Ÿ’ก Tips for caring for clothes after removing stains

  1. Test fabric for chemical resistance: Before applying any product, test it on an inconspicuous area of โ€‹โ€‹the fabric.
  2. Use cold water: Hot water can โ€œbakeโ€ the stain, making it even more durable.
  3. Don't rub the stain: This will only make the situation worse. Better to blot it gently.
  4. Post-Wash Treatment: After removing the stain, washing will help remove product residue and possible odors.

๐Ÿ‹ Fruit stains: features and recommendations

๐ŸApple

Apple stains can usually be removed easily with cold water. If the stain is stubborn, you can use a solution of vinegar and water.

๐ŸŠ Orange

To remove orange stains, it is recommended to use a mixture of lemon juice and salt. After treating the stain, clothes should be washed thoroughly.

๐Ÿ Pineapple

Pineapple stains can be acidic and irritating. It's best to use a mild soap and water solution to remove them.

๐Ÿ“ Berry stains: how to deal with them?

๐Ÿ‡ Grapes

Grape stains are known to be stubborn. To remove them, it is recommended to blot the stain with cold water, then treat with a mixture of lemon juice and salt. After this, rinse the fabric thoroughly.

๐Ÿ’ Cherry

Cherry stains can be easily removed with a mixture of vinegar and water. Apply the solution to the stain, leave for 15 minutes, then rinse.

๐Ÿ“ Strawberry

Strawberry stains can be removed using a mixture of baking soda and water. Apply the paste to the stain, leave it on for a while, then rinse thoroughly.

๐Ÿšซ What to avoid

  • Don't use hot water on fresh stains as this will only make them worse.
  • Avoid rubbing the stain to avoid damaging the fabric.
  • Do not mix chemicals as this may cause a chemical reaction.

๐Ÿงช Chemicals: when natural methods donโ€™t help

Sometimes home methods may not be effective, especially if the stain is old or too deep. In such cases, specialized chemicals come to the rescue.

  1. Stain removers: There are many stain removers designed specifically for removing stains from fruits and berries. Before use, be sure to read the instructions.
  2. Whiteness: Use with caution as it may damage or discolor the fabric.
  3. Acetone: Effective against fruit stains, but may damage some fabrics.
